Abstract

Flooded is a classic thing in every area, especially in the capital city. Floods in Jakarta cannot be separated from the role of the community in urban areas and villages within the town. People's behavior in everyday life, the condition of infrastructure in the community is critical in overcoming flood problems and external causes such as high rainfall, global warming, and climate change. People's behavior that ignores environmental cleanliness such as littering, changing the function of infiltration land as a residence without thinking about environmental impacts, community participation in the maintenance, and lack of concern for the condition of drainage infrastructure in the environment has a vital role. The absence of supervision, respect and local government's role is also one of the causes of the poorly maintained drainage system in settlements

Abstract

Garbage is a very complicated problem and will occur continuously throughout the world, inseparable in Indonesia in general and especially in the capital city . In terms of waste management in Jakarta so far, it is still not good, considering that the waste management handled by the local government can only be seen from the Temporary Waste Disposal Plant to the Final Waste Disposal Plant. This can be seen from the condition of the garbage carts which are very unfit for the size of a Metropolitan City, Jakarta is an icon and barometer of all cities in Indonesia, but the condition of the garbage transport equipment does not reflect a big city that is identical with everything that is clean and tidy. One part of waste management management is a garbage cart, the management of a garbage cart does not reflect that a garbage cart is for the capital city. Garbage carts are rickety, smelly, dirty, dirty, the transported garbage falls scattered, the garbage collectors are also dirty and smelly without being equipped with makeshift tools and makeshift clothes
